About this session

St Andrew’s is a community-based youth club and a registered charity which enriches young lives by providing a sense of belonging, fun and informal education to over 500 members each year, where they develop self-confidence, respect for others and build their abilities to contribute to society as good citizens.

There are pockets of extreme deprivation around the Club’s base where many of the members live: The surrounding area is amongst the 20% most deprived neighbourhoods in the country and the Child Poverty Action Group shows Westminster is one of the London boroughs with the highest rates of child poverty, Many local children can’t afford to have friends round for tea or a snack, and can’t afford a hobby or leisure activity.

This is why the youth club is vital. It is one of five Westminster ‘Youth Hubs’ delivering youth-led initiatives. It offers opportunities in a safe, attractive environment for young people to develop educationally, socially and personally through a range of sport, art, excursions and practical skills.

But it needs help from volunteers to keep it running. Andrew, the manager, has asked us to come and help organise the garage so it can be more effectively used to store resources. We will be emptying the space, giving it a tidy and reorganising. This will be a really helpful way to contribute to the important work the centre is doing for young people.
